Output f6bead3f8b043924ddbcf245ab6199b131cf8657658c1c740a54a62a3b2722f2:0

value
575586
script pubkey
OP_HASH160 OP_PUSHBYTES_20 914915bb43d0b3e8410c2f82ec157ce8d02d349d OP_EQUAL
address
3EwDTPMcWgkzK2oJwZy7BATEzC9Ejnq37d
transaction
f6bead3f8b043924ddbcf245ab6199b131cf8657658c1c740a54a62a3b2722f2
confirmations
290201
spent
true